Today the Institute has 13 laboratories, 3

machine rooms and

a computer centre. The Institute has 700

staff, 300 of whom are at the engineer and lecturer level and

above, and 60 senior staff of the professor level. In addition

there are about 100 persons every year doing research for Master's or Doctorate degrees.

During our discussion with the Director of the

Institute, Professor WANG Dachong, we asked whether the PWR

(Pressurized Water Reactor) design was outdated. Prof. WANG said

that the PWR design has been tested for a good number of reactors

its safety has been proved.

So The study of years and

called

"safe reactors" are meaningful but at the present moment it is at a conceptual stage. It is not expected to replace the PWR within the present century. On being asked how the PWR compares with other types of reactors Prof. WANG said that the safety features

of the PWR have already been well studied; at the present moment

the BWR (Boiling Water Reactor) and PWR are the two mature types

of commercial reactors. The national policy of China is to

develop PWR.
